~ahasenack/landscape-client/landscape-client-1.5.5-0ubuntu0.9.04.0

« back to all changes in this revision

Viewing changes to dbus/landscape.conf

  • Committer: Bazaar Package Importer
  • Author(s): Rick Clark
  • Date: 2008-09-08 16:35:57 UTC
  • mfrom: (1.1.1 upstream)
  • Revision ID: james.westby@ubuntu.com-20080908163557-l3ixzj5dxz37wnw2
Tags: 1.0.18-0ubuntu1
New upstream release 

Show diffs side-by-side

added added

removed removed

Lines of Context:
 
1
<!DOCTYPE busconfig PUBLIC
 
2
 "-//freedesktop//DTD D-BUS Bus Configuration 1.0//EN"
 
3
 "http://www.freedesktop.org/standards/dbus/1.0/busconfig.dtd">
 
4
<busconfig>
 
5
 
 
6
  <policy user="landscape">
 
7
    <allow own="com.canonical.landscape.Broker" />
 
8
    <allow own="com.canonical.landscape.Monitor" />
 
9
 
 
10
    <allow send_destination="com.canonical.landscape.Broker" />
 
11
    <allow receive_sender="com.canonical.landscape.Broker" />
 
12
 
 
13
    <allow send_destination="com.canonical.landscape.Monitor" />
 
14
    <allow receive_sender="com.canonical.landscape.Monitor" />
 
15
 
 
16
    <allow send_destination="com.canonical.landscape.Manager" />
 
17
    <allow receive_sender="com.canonical.landscape.Manager" />
 
18
 
 
19
    <allow send_interface="org.freedesktop.Hal.Manager" />
 
20
    <allow send_interface="org.freedesktop.Hal.Device" />
 
21
 
 
22
  </policy>
 
23
 
 
24
  <!-- this is a horrible hack -->
 
25
  <policy user="haldaemon">
 
26
 
 
27
    <allow receive_sender="com.canonical.landscape.Manager" />
 
28
    <allow receive_sender="com.canonical.landscape.Monitor" />
 
29
    <allow receive_sender="com.canonical.landscape.Broker" />
 
30
 
 
31
  </policy>
 
32
 
 
33
  <policy user="root">
 
34
    <allow own="com.canonical.landscape.Manager" />
 
35
 
 
36
    <allow send_destination="com.canonical.landscape.Broker" />
 
37
    <allow receive_sender="com.canonical.landscape.Broker" />
 
38
 
 
39
    <allow send_destination="com.canonical.landscape.Monitor" />
 
40
    <allow receive_sender="com.canonical.landscape.Monitor" />
 
41
 
 
42
    <allow send_destination="com.canonical.landscape.Manager" />
 
43
    <allow receive_sender="com.canonical.landscape.Manager" />
 
44
  </policy>
 
45
 
 
46
  <policy context="default">
 
47
    <deny own="com.canonical.landscape.Broker" />
 
48
    <deny own="com.canonical.landscape.Monitor" />
 
49
    <deny own="com.canonical.landscape.Manager" />
 
50
 
 
51
    <deny send_destination="com.canonical.landscape.Broker" />
 
52
    <deny receive_sender="com.canonical.landscape.Broker" />
 
53
 
 
54
    <deny send_destination="com.canonical.landscape.Monitor" />
 
55
    <deny receive_sender="com.canonical.landscape.Monitor" />
 
56
 
 
57
    <deny send_destination="com.canonical.landscape.Manager" />
 
58
    <deny receive_sender="com.canonical.landscape.Manager" />
 
59
 
 
60
  </policy>
 
61
 
 
62
</busconfig>